How much do honda part time j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for honda part time in Michigan is $20.95,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.48 and $23.89 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ical work shifts and scheduling expectations for a Honda part time position?

Honda part-time roles generally offer flexible scheduling to accommodate students, parents, or those seeking supplemental income. Shifts may vary by department, but most part-time employees can expect to work between 15 and 30 hours per week, often during evenings, weekends, or holidays depending on operational needs. It's common to coordinate schedules with a supervisor, and some roles may require availability during peak business hours or for occasional overtime. Open communication with your manager is encouraged to find a schedule that balances company needs with your personal commitments.

What is a Honda part time?

Honda part-time jobs are employment opportunities at Honda dealerships, manufacturing plants, or corporate offices that require employees to work fewer hours than a full-time schedule, typically under 30-35 hours per week. These roles can include positions in customer service, administration, sales, warehouse operations, or assembly lines. Part-time jobs at Honda are ideal for students, individuals seeking flexible work hours, or those looking to gain experience in the automotive industry. Honda offers part-time employees the chance to develop valuable skills, earn competitive wages, and sometimes receive benefits depending on the location and role. What is the difference between Honda Part Time vs Honda Service Advisor?

AspectHonda Part TimeHonda Service Advisor
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some technical knowledgeHigh school diploma; customer service skills; some technical knowledge
Work EnvironmentDealerships, retail settings, flexible hoursDealership service departments, customer-facing roles
Industry UsageAutomotive retail, parts salesAutomotive service, customer communication
Common Search/ComparisonPart Time vs Service Advisor

Honda Part Time roles typically involve assisting with parts sales or inventory in a dealership, often with flexible hours. Honda Service Advisors focus on communicating with customers, scheduling repairs, and explaining services. While both roles are within the dealership environment and may require some technical knowledge, Service Advisors have more customer interaction and sales responsibilities. Understanding these differences helps job seekers find the role that best matches their skills and career goals.

Job description

Novi, MI - 61
Department: Driver
Employment Type: Part Time
Location: Novi, Michigan 48376
Compensation: $17.00 / hour
Description
Driver on Demand ("DOD") - A national provider of screened and certified drivers to automotive dealers and leading car companies such as Lincoln, Ford, Acura, Honda and most other major brands. DOD provides high quality drivers to forward thinking local auto dealers that are focused on a new level of customer experience - allowing customers to service their vehicles without ever leaving their home or office.
We take customer service very seriously and have a growing team of hard-working, passionate and energetic drivers that assist our clients. We are looking for pleasant tech savvy drivers that will help local dealers pick up and deliver customer vehicles. DOD has over 500 drivers spanning 40 major US metros.
  • Drive luxury vehicles and meet great people
  • Independent Contractor position (1099)
  • Earn $17/hr driving without using your own vehicle
  • Part-time shift from 8am - 12:30pm or 12:30pm - 5pm , Monday - Friday
  • Direct deposit paid weekly
  • Nationwide certification to drive in any DOD market - currently in 40 major US metros

Key Responsibilities
  • Pick up and drop off customer vehicles
  • Following driving routes and time schedules
  • Arrive at destinations on schedule
  • Interact with clients professionally at all times
  • Exceptional customer service
  • Follow regulations and safety standards

Skills Knowledge and Expertise
  • Must be tech savvy (navigate while using an app)
  • 5+ years of consistent and clean driving history
  • Valid in-state driver's license
  • Excellent navigation skills and proficiency in using navigation applications
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ills to interact with clients
  • Time management and organizational skills to keep track of trips and stay on schedule
  • Clean background
